- [ ] Key ceremony, item 4: query planner regression. The Drossvale planner started picking nested-loop joins after the stats refresh; p95 up 6x on reporting queries. Fix is gated behind the signed config bundle, which can't ship until the ceremony key is rotated. Rotation done, bundle signed, regression test green as of this morning. Flagging for the weekly sync so nobody re-opens it. To unseal the backup signer if the bundle needs re-signing, use the recovery passphrase below.

recovery phrase for hafop-bajef: rusael-belath-drumir-wenok-gordor-oliox

Off-site run checklist — item 7: Sample shipments to Corvandale Labs. Confirm all twelve sample tubes from the Mirelight project are double-bagged, chilled, and packed in the grey transit case with fresh gel packs. Verify the chain-of-custody form is signed by both the lab liaison and the packer before sealing. The case must not leave the cold room until the courier is physically on site and has presented credentials. Once verified, proceed per the confidential courier hand-over instruction noted directly below this item.

drop instructions, yafog-yawip: the quenmir olidor courier leaves the julox tamion keliel ledger at gate 5283 under passcode 336825

Handover note — Crumbwheel order cutoffs.

Welcome aboard. The bakery cutoff rule in Crumbwheel closes same-day orders at 14:00 local to each storefront, not UTC — this has bitten us twice. Holiday overrides live in the calendar service and take precedence silently, so always check there first when a cutoff looks wrong. To unlock the calendar service's admin console after a restart, enter the recovery passphrase below.

vault phrase of bagap-bahaf = silion-pelox-sorox-casdor-quenwyn-fraax-eliox-praael-kelion-quenvan-kasox-rusael-norius-belvan

# Break-Glass: Catalog Cache Invalidation

Scope: the Pinrow product catalog at Veldstone Retail. If stale prices persist after a purge and the Hollowmere invalidation queue is wedged, use break-glass to flush the edge tier directly. Contractors: get verbal sign-off from the catalog lead first. Steps: open the Hollowmere admin shell, select emergency-flush, confirm the tenant, and run it once — repeated flushes thrash the origin. Access is logged and expires after 20 minutes. Unseal the admin shell with the passphrase below.

recovery phrase for kahop-tajog: istix-casvan